Preferred Qualifications:
  • Independently plans and drives programs and projects of significant complexity and risks.
  • Responsible for the overall direction, coordination, implementation, execution, control, and completion of projects.
  • Organizes the overall project team and establishes clear roles and responsibilities at the beginning of each project.
  • Analyzes project plan to identify and mitigate risks and minimize potential roadblocks.
  • Collaborates with GPOs, BizApps and BPAs from various functions to create detailed project plan.
  • Schedules and prepares meeting materials for project team meetings, including kickoff, testing kick-off and sign-off, go/no-go, post-mortem, etc.
  • Facilitates meetings by sending meeting agendas, capturing and distributing meeting minutes, and capturing and tracking issues reported during all phases of the project.
  • Drives assigned team actions to resolution by working with action owners.
  • Proactively identifies dependencies between teams, resolves issues, and ensures all plans align on delivery criteria.
  • Influences decision making and problem solving across projects, programs, and teams.
  • Closes projects and reports overall level of success to sponsors and stakeholders, and identifies lessons learned for continuous improvement.
